On **subsequent use** or when the user asks to skip, go directly to the main output. ## Scope (Off-Page SEO) - **Link building**: Acquire backlinks from relevant, authoritative sites - **Broken link building**: Find broken links on others' sites; suggest your content as replacement - **Unlinked brand mentions**: Turn mentions into links via outreach - **Guest posting**: Contribute to relevant publications; earn links - **Journalist requests**: Respond to #JournoRequest; provide quotes/assets - **Digital PR**: PR campaigns for backlinks and E-E-A-T — see **eeat-signals** ## Initial Assessment **Check for project context first:** If `.claude/project-context.md` or `.cursor/project-context.md` exists, read it for product, audience, and proof points.
